dombom
概念和method:在 DOM 中,文檔中的各個組件(component),可以通過 object.attribute 這種形式來訪問。一個 DOM 會有一個根對象,這個對象通常就是 document。
而 BOM 除了可以訪問文檔中的組件之外,還可以訪問瀏覽器的組件,比如問題描述中的 navigator(導航條)、history(歷史記錄)等等。
?
content和應用:文檔對象模型(Document Object Model,簡稱DOM),是W3C組織推薦的處理可擴展標志語言的標準編程接口。Document Object Model的歷史可以追溯至1990年代后期微軟與Netscape的“瀏覽器大戰”,雙方為了在JavaScript與JScript一決生死,于是大規模的賦予瀏覽器強大的功能。微軟在網頁技術上加入了不少專屬事物,計有VBScript、ActiveX、以及微軟自家的DHTML格式等,使不少網頁使用非微軟平臺及瀏覽器無法正常顯示。DOM即是當時蘊釀出來的杰作。
BOM(Browser Object Mode) 是指瀏覽器對象模型,是用于描述這種對象與對象之間層次關系的模型,瀏覽器對象模型提供了獨立于內容的、可以與瀏覽器窗口進行互動的對象結構。BOM由多個對象組成,其中代表瀏覽器窗口的Window對象是BOM的頂層對象,其他對象都是該對象的子對象。
?
轉載于:https://www.cnblogs.com/JinQyuh/p/9823595.html
創作挑戰賽新人創作獎勵來咯,堅持創作打卡瓜分現金大獎總結
- 上一篇: kafka 服务端消费者和生产者的配置
- 下一篇: 在VS中进行对项目进行编译出现不能编译的